Club 59 is a nightlife venue in central Basel that blends a bar, lounge, and club under one roof. The venue’s official website lists it at Steinenvorstadt 33, 4051 Basel, placing it in one of the city’s best-known going-out streets. According to the club, it has been part of Basel’s nightlife since 1959 and has been operated in its current form since 2012. The venue describes itself as a place where the bar experience transitions naturally into the dance floor. In the lounge and bar area, Club 59 says it focuses on a broad drinks selection, including cocktails, wines, champagne, single malts, gins, and other spirits. Club 59’s official “About” page says the venue sits in the middle of the Steinenvorstadt, a street the club describes as one of Basel’s best-known nightlife areas. The same page also notes that, in summer, the venue runs an outdoor bar with a terrace directly on the boulevard. Music is a central part of the venue’s identity. The club says its DJs play a wide range of styles, including disco, party music, mashups, house, and classic selections from the 1980s and 1990s. That suggests a crowd-friendly program rather than a single-genre club concept, which can make Club 59 a practical choice for groups with mixed tastes. The official contact page lists opening hours for both bar service and disco nights. It states that bar service runs Monday to Thursday from 11:30 to 01:00, Friday to Saturday from 11:30 to 02:00, and on Sunday from 14:00 to 01:00. Disco hours are listed for Friday and Saturday only, from 22:00 to 05:00, with the club closed for disco on other days.
